Description
This is a house from the 18th century with later alterations, located adjoining the east end of Cross View Cottage in Alston Moor's Market Place. The building is constructed of wet-dashed rubble and features a graduated stone-flagged roof with a stone chimney at the east end. It has two bays and stands three storeys tall, with attics. On the left side, there is a panelled door, while to the right, a two-storey canted bay window under a flat roof has narrow sashes without glazing bars on the sides and a single sash on each floor at the front. The first-floor door on the left is now blocked, and there is a single sash window on the second floor, along with a small fixed attic window.
